The rift between Raekwon and RZA has disappointed many Wu-Tang fans. The group is expected to release new projects this year, and Raekwon was formerly omitted from the recording process. However, it appears the two have came to a mutual understanding, as reported below:

“It looks as if RZA and Raekwon have reconciled.

After going back and forth for the past month over the recording of their upcoming album, “A Better Tomorrow,” “Raekwon scheduled to hit studio to complete verses for album,” reads a statement on the Wu-Tang Clan’s official site.

The Beef: RZA & Raekwon Bicker Over Wu-Tang Clan’s ‘A Better Tomorrow’ Album

The two have been feuding over “A Better Tomorrow” due to creative differences and lack of communication.”
